In the artist’s words: Describe one of your earliest musical memories in detail. As a 9 year old I peered into my neighbor's basement window to watch his rock band practice. From that moment onward, I knew what I wanted to do. What are your top 3 all-time favorite albums on Apple Music, and why? Why did you choose these three albums in particular? CAKE, Comfort Eagle Dinosaur Jr., You're Living All Over Me (Remastered) The Jimi Hendrix Experience, Axis: Bold As Love Great albums from beginning to end. It's rare when every song on an album holds its own, especially when it's all groundbreaking and boundary-pushing, but these albums cover that. Find a song of yours on Apple Music that you love and tell us what makes it special. Tell us why you chose this song. “Smackeroo” This was the first song I did where I recorded two separate drum parts. I played them each on different drum kits, too, and you can hear the difference as the drums play off each other in each of the breakdowns in this song. What’s one of the most memorable moments in your career so far? I have shared the stage with some aweseome bands over the years, including Fugazi, Bikini Kill, L7, Jesus Lizard, Sebadoh, and Slint. Is there anything left on your bucket list as an artist or band? Making enough money to quit my day job would be the dream, right? Instead of releasing an album a year on my own, perhaps getting picked up by a label. Now that I think about it, collaborating with others would be pretty cool too.
